The Stork Is Real!

Do you really believe that precious life comes from disgusting body fluids? The Truth is, babies are brought into the world by a pure white angel, the Stork.


  1. #1 Livia Blackburne
    June 27, 2010

    Heh. Cute, but probably not the most helpful for building any bridges between the scientific and religious communities.

  2. #2 leigh van valen
    June 29, 2010

    Well, there’s the classic correlation between (human) birth rate and the number of storks in Denmark.

